What Internal Temperatures Should You Aim for Different Levels of Steak Doneness?

The best temperatures to finish steak in the oven vary depending on the desired level of doneness:

  • Rare: Aim for an internal temperature of about 120°F (49°C).
  • Medium Rare: Target an internal temperature of 130°F (54°C).
  • Medium: Aim for an internal temperature of 140°F (60°C).
  • Medium Well: Target an internal temperature of 150°F (66°C).
  • Well Done: Aim for an internal temperature of 160°F (71°C) or higher.

Rare steaks are characterized by their cool, red center and soft texture. Cooking to this temperature allows the natural flavors of the meat to shine through, making it a favorite for those who enjoy a more tender cut.

Medium Rare steaks are often considered the ideal doneness by chefs, as they offer a warm, red center and a juicy texture. This temperature allows the fat to render properly, enhancing the steak’s flavor and tenderness.

Medium steaks have a warm pink center with less juiciness than Medium Rare. At this temperature, the meat is firmer and the flavor is still robust, appealing to those who prefer a bit more firmness without sacrificing all the moisture.

Medium Well steaks have a slight hint of pink in the center, with a firmer texture and reduced juiciness. This doneness is suitable for those who prefer a well-cooked steak but still want some semblance of flavor and tenderness.

Well Done steaks are cooked through completely, with no pink remaining, resulting in a firmer texture and a more pronounced charred flavor. While this level of doneness may appeal to certain tastes, it often leads to a drier steak, making proper cooking techniques crucial for maintaining some level of moisture.

What Internal Temperature Defines a Rare Steak?

The internal temperature that defines a rare steak typically falls between 120°F to 125°F (49°C to 52°C).

  • 120°F (49°C): At this temperature, the steak is very red in the center and warm throughout. The meat will be soft and tender, showcasing its natural juices without being fully cooked.
  • 125°F (52°C): This is at the upper end of the rare spectrum, where the steak still maintains a bright red, cool center. It has a slightly firmer texture compared to 120°F, while still providing a rich, beefy flavor that many steak enthusiasts appreciate.
  • Cooking Method: To achieve a rare steak, it’s often recommended to sear the meat in a hot pan or grill before finishing it in an oven preheated to around 400°F (204°C). This allows for a delicious crust on the outside while gently bringing the internal temperature up to the desired level.
  • Resting Period: After cooking, it’s crucial to let the steak rest for about 5-10 minutes. This allows the juices to redistribute throughout the meat, enhancing flavor and tenderness, while also raising the internal temperature slightly due to carryover cooking.

What Techniques Can Improve the Quality of Oven-Finished Steak?

Several techniques can enhance the quality of oven-finished steak:

  • Reverse Searing: This technique involves cooking the steak slowly in the oven at a low temperature before searing it on a hot pan. By starting in the oven, the steak cooks evenly throughout, which helps retain its juices and results in a tender texture.
  • Proper Seasoning: Seasoning your steak with salt and pepper before cooking is essential for flavor enhancement. Allowing the steak to sit after seasoning lets the salt penetrate the meat, leading to a more flavorful and well-seasoned finished product.
  • Using a Meat Thermometer: Monitoring the internal temperature of the steak with a meat thermometer ensures that it reaches the desired doneness without overcooking. This precision helps you achieve the best temperature for finishing your steak in the oven.
  • Resting the Steak: After finishing in the oven, letting the steak rest for several minutes allows the juices to redistribute within the meat. This step is crucial for maintaining moisture and ensuring that each bite is juicy and flavorful.
  • Oven Temperature Control: The best temperature to finish steak in the oven is generally around 375°F (190°C), which allows for even cooking without drying out the meat. Adjusting the temperature based on the thickness of the steak can also help achieve the perfect doneness.

What Common Mistakes Should Be Avoided When Finishing Steak in the Oven?

Common mistakes to avoid when finishing steak in the oven include:

  • Not Preheating the Oven: Failing to preheat the oven can lead to uneven cooking and a longer cooking time, which may result in overcooked meat. Preheating ensures that the steak starts cooking immediately, promoting a better sear and overall texture.
  • Using the Wrong Temperature: Cooking steak at too high or too low a temperature can negatively affect its doneness. The best temperature to finish steak in the oven is typically around 400°F to 450°F, as this range allows for a good balance between cooking through and developing a nice crust.
  • Not Using a Meat Thermometer: Relying solely on cooking times instead of checking the internal temperature can lead to overcooking or undercooking the steak. A meat thermometer provides accurate readings for doneness, ensuring that the steak reaches the desired level—rare to medium-rare is usually around 130°F to 135°F.
  • Skipping the Resting Period: Cutting into a steak immediately after taking it out of the oven can cause the juices to run out, leading to a dry piece of meat. Allowing the steak to rest for about 5 to 10 minutes helps the juices redistribute, resulting in a more flavorful and tender steak.
  • Using a Cold Steak: Starting with a steak that is too cold can lead to uneven cooking. Allowing the steak to come to room temperature for about 30 minutes before cooking promotes a more even cook throughout the meat.
  • Not Searing First: Cooking steak directly in the oven without searing it first can result in a less appealing crust. Searing the steak in a hot pan before finishing in the oven enhances flavor through the Maillard reaction, creating a delicious outer layer.
